- Print
- DarkLight
Otto-js is a security-focused JavaScript monitoring platform that detects and prevents data leaks in real time. It provides visibility into script behavior, protecting sensitive data in web apps and third-party integrations. Learn more on the Otto-js webpage.
Integration Method: API
OCSF Tables: Vulnerability Finding, Incident Finding
Configuration Overview
Get an API token from Otto
Add the Otto-js datafeed integration in the DataBee console with the required API token
Parameter Mapping
DataBee Feed Parameter | Otto-js Parameter |
Token | API Token |
Otto-js Configuration
To get an API Token, submit a request to support@otto-js.com with the subject "API KEY REQUEST".
DataBee Configuration
To configure the data source,
Login to the DataBee UI, navigate to Data > Data Feeds and click the Add New Data Feed button
Search for the Otto-js tile and click it as shown below
Click on the API Ingest option for collection method. Enter feed contact information and click Next
Configuration Details
In the configuration page, confirm the following:
API Base URL: This is the base URL that DataBee will interact with
Authorization Method: Bearer Token
Token: Paste the API Token generated earlier in the Otto-js console
Event types: Preselected for all the events types the integration pulls
Click Submit
Troubleshooting Tips
Ensure the token is pasted correctly. Since you cannot view the token after the 1st time, re-create the token, paste it on a text editor to ensure no spaces or unexpected characters are included and reconfigure the DataBee feed
Ensure the Otto-js scope/permissions is set correctly